True story: I ran out of flour because my gluten-free sourdough starter ate it all. 

But I wanted to make pancakes and there my sourdough starter was, all full and ready to be used

…so I put on my thinking cap and I whipped up a batch of sourdough pancakes using sourdough discard only and no additional flour. Cue the bells, whistles, and parade!

All you need is sourdough discard, an egg, butter/ghee/oil, baking powder and baking soda. THAT’S it!

The result? Pancakes that actually taste like sourdough, are nice and squishy, not at all fluffy, soft and chewy, but did I mention not fluffy?

Just thought I would set the proper expectation.

Actually, these pancakes remind me of 50’s diner-style flapjacks…you know the ones that are actually flat instead of fluffy? That’s these. But gluten-free. And tasting all sourdough like.
